Victim shot during argument on Pulaski Highway

Baltimore police vehicle - BSP - Stock Photo.

BALTIMORE, MD – On August 22, 2021, at approximately 8:49 p.m., Southern District patrol officers were dispatched to the 3100 block of Pulaski Highway for a shooting investigation.

Once at the location, officers located a 21- year-old male victim suffering from an apparent gunshot wound to the shoulder. The victim was transported to an area hospital and is listed in stable condition. A preliminary investigation revealed that the victim had a physical altercation with the suspect, who then brandished a firearm and then shot the victim.

Southern District Shooting detectives responded to the scene and assumed control over the investigation. Anyone with information is urged to contact Southern District Shooting detectives at 410-396-2499.
